So What Exactly is PersonifAI? (And Why Should You Care?)

Forget thinking of this as just another chatbot builder. That's like calling a movie studio just a camera. PersonifAI is more like a digital puppet theater where you get to design the puppets, write the script, and then let them improvise. It’s a platform where you can create unique AI “personas,” give them goals and personalities, define how they interact through “Flows,” and then unleash them in simulations to see what happens.

Why should you, a savvy SEO, marketer, or developer, care? Because this is where the theoretical meets the practical. You can:

  • Test a marketing campaign by creating customer personas and an AI sales agent to see how they react.
  • Prototype a complex customer service workflow with multiple AI agents handling different parts of a query.
  • Write dynamic stories where AI characters with their own motivations interact and build a narrative together.

It’s about moving from a single AI conversation to building and observing an entire AI ecosystem. And you can do it without writing a single line of code. That's the part that really got my attention.

The Core Features That Actually Matter

A tool is only as good as its features, but a long list of bells and whistles can be deceiving. After playing around for a while, here’s the stuff that I found genuinely useful.

Crafting Your Digital Characters with AI Personas

This is the heart of PersonifAI. You’re not just picking a voice; you’re building a personality from the ground up. You can define their background, their goals, their knowledge base, even their quirks. But the real kicker is the model selection. You’re not locked into one AI. You can choose from the heavy hitters: GPT-4o, Gemini, Claude, and Llama. This is huge. Anyone who’s been in the AI space knows that different models have different strengths. Want raw creative power? Maybe you pick a Claude model. Need cutting-edge multimodal ability? GPT-4o is your guy. This flexibility is, in my opinion, a non-negotiable feature for a serious AI tool today.

Making Them Interact with Workflows and Chats

Once you have your cast of characters, you need to give them direction. That's where "Flows" come in. These are basically visual roadmaps that dictate how your AI personas interact with each other and with certain triggers. Think of it as setting up the rules of the game. For instance, "If Customer Persona asks about shipping, route them to the Logistics Bot AI." You can set up simple one-on-one chats (Solo Conversations) or throw everyone into a room together (Group Conversations) to see what chaos, or genius, ensues. I found this part surprisingly intuitive. It feels like drawing a flowchart, which is way more my speed than wrestling with API calls.

The Grand Experiment: Running AI Simulations

This is the payoff. After all your setup, you hit 'run' and watch your creation come to life. The simulation is a controlled environment where your AIs do their thing based on the personas and flows you designed. You can analyze the outcomes, see where conversations went wrong, predict behavior, and tweak your strategies. It's like A/B testing for... well, for almost anything you can imagine. It’s an incredible way to find those weird edge cases you’d never think of on your own.

How Much Does This AI Playground Cost?

So, the big question: what’s the damage? The pricing is actually pretty straightforward and, in my view, quite reasonable for what you're getting. They call it your "PersonifAI Journey," which is a bit cheesy, but the tiers make sense.

Plan Price Who It's For
Observer $0 / month The curious tinkerer. You get 25 credits/month and access to the core models. Perfect for seeing if the platform fits your vibe without any commitment.
Creator $10 / month The active builder or small business owner. This bumps you up to 100 credits/month. This feels like the sweet spot for most regular users who are building and testing things consistently.
Architect $25 / month The power user, agency, or developer. With 275 credits/month and access to all the premium, cutting-edge AI models, this is for people running extensive tests or building complex commercial applications.

You can check out the full details on their pricing page. For my money, the Creator plan offers the best bang for your buck to start with.

Frequently Asked Questions About PersonifAI

Can I really use PersonifAI without coding?

Absolutely. That’s one of its main draws. The entire interface is built around visual builders and simple inputs. If you can make a flowchart, you can build a simulation in PersonifAI.

Which AI models does PersonifAI support?

It gives you access to the big four: GPT-4o (from OpenAI), Gemini (from Google), Claude (from Anthropic), and Llama (from Meta). The top-tier plan provides access to the most advanced versions of these models.

Is the free plan actually useful?

I'd say it's useful for exploration. You can definitely get a feel for the platform, build a simple persona, and run a few tests. But the 25-credit limit means you won't be running large-scale experiments. Think of it as a generous, unlimited-time demo.

What exactly is a "simulation credit"?

While they don't define it to the letter, my experience suggests it's tied to the processing power used. A simple, short simulation might use one credit, while a more complex one with multiple AI personas and long interactions could use more. Each run consumes some credits.

How is this different from just using the regular ChatGPT or Claude websites?

That's the key difference. ChatGPT is a one-to-one conversational tool. PersonifAI is a one-to-many simulation platform. You're not just chatting; you're creating a system of interacting AI agents and observing their collective behavior. It's about systems, not just sentences.
